The1982 United States Senate election in Washington was held on November 2, 1982. IncumbentDemocratHenry M. Jackson defeatedRepublican nominee Douglas Jewett with 68.96% of the vote.

Primary election

[edit]

Primary elections were held on September 14, 1982.[1]

Results

[edit]
1982 United States Senate election in Washington[2]
PartyCandidateVotes%±%
DemocraticHenry M. Jackson (incumbent)943,66568.96%
RepublicanDouglas Jewett332,27324.28%
IndependentKing Lysen72,2975.28%
IndependentJesse Chiang20,2511.48%
Majority611,39244.68%
Turnout1,368,486
DemocraticholdSwing
